 The popularity of the movie "Black Swan" had a significant impact on fashion spring-summer 2011 season. The theme of the ballet has found its reflection in the regular clothes, shoes and even hairstyles. Undisputed hit of this season was the makeup in the style of a ballerina.

This make-up is classified as everyday wear make-up and will fit almost any woman, young or mature, blonde or brunette, business woman or housewife, a lover of classical and bright fashionistas.

Make-up is done in pastel colors. Tonal basis should be possible to match your skin color, the same applies to the powder. In addition, it is better to use a light crumbly powder with a little fine velvety texture. For ballet wear make-up used a light pink or peach blush, which applies only to the cheekbones and carefully spread over the cheeks. This color should be a natural healthy look.

Makeup in the style of a ballerina focuses on the eyes. They need to be expressive and dramatic. To achieve this result, you should use a mascara lengthens the effect or even false eyelashes, but not too long and thick, otherwise the image may get too bright. Eye dark pencil or liquid eyeliner, draw a thin graceful arrows. Arrows can be made in different colors: brown, blue or classic black, but they are, in any case should not be too bright or inaccurate.

Lips makeup a la ballerina stress should not be so discreet lipstick should be, or even natural skin color. In order to be well-groomed lips looking to put on them a little bit of foundation, and then cover the transparent lip gloss.

It is best to look like makeup with hairstyles from the collected hair at the nape: beam, high ponytail or braid climb up. However, the make-up can be worn with hairstyles from short hair. The main thing - the person should remain as open as possible.
